Maalaala Mo Kaya (MMK), the longest-running drama anthology in the Philippines, is back on free TV and digital streaming services after a two-year hiatus. It will return on iWantTFC as a limited series on April 24. Two days later, it will be broadcast on A2Z, Kapamilya Online (Live), and Kapamilya Channel.

The show said goodbye to its audience back in November 2022 when its last episode aired on December 10 of the same year.

Extending the legacy

At the ABS-CBN Ball, the show's host, Charo Santos-Concio, revealed the news and expressed her delight for the anthology's return, which has long been a mainstay of Filipino home entertainment. 

“In my heart, I knew that one day babalik siya. Because the loyal viewers and the new generation of viewers are looking forward to watching the true-to-life stories of our Kapamilyas,” the award-winning actress said.

“Ang daming Gen Z na lumaki na nanonood ng MMK kasama ang kanilang mommies and daddies, lolas and lolos. I'm so happy that they know MMK is a brand of good storytelling.”

First episodes lined up

The first few episodes that the host-actress has planned for this comeback season were also revealed. 

These include the life story of one of the BINI members and the life of Sofronio Vasquez, the first Filipino to win the American franchise of The Voice.

MMK has received numerous awards during its 31-year run, garnering both domestic and international acclaim for its cast and production crew.
